No flu cases so far in county

Health authorities reported that, as of Press-Banner press time Wednesday, May 6, no swine flu cases had been confirmed in Santa Cruz County.

So far, samples from 144 possible cases of swine flu, or H1N1, had been forwarded for testing to a regional laboratory in Santa Clara County. Results for the most recent cases may not be known for up to seven days, officials said.

Of confirmed cases in the U.S., nearly all have been mild, and the county Health Services Agency continues to advise those with flu-like symptoms stay at home, rest and eat and drink normally. Only if symptoms become severe should a patient consult his or her doctor, officials said.
